Beyond the Wet Wipe: Understanding the Need for Deeper Dog Paw Cleaning
When you take your dog out for a walk, their paws are like sponges, soaking up everything from the environment. Think about what they encounter: dusty trails, muddy puddles, grass, pavement, and even hidden bits of debris. These aren’t just harmless elements; they can carry allergens, irritants, and various microorganisms. Simply wiping with a wet cloth often just redistributes this cocktail of outdoor elements, pushing it deeper into the fur between their pads or missing critical areas altogether.
Leaving paws unclean can lead to several problems. For your dog, persistent dirt and moisture can cause skin irritation, dryness, or even bacterial and fungal infections between their toes. Imagine walking around with tiny pieces of grit stuck in your shoes all day; that’s a mild comparison to what your dog might experience. Furthermore, any harmful bacteria or parasites picked up outside can easily be brought into your home, transferring to furniture, carpets, and even us.
The Hidden Dangers Lurking on Paws
It’s more than just visible mud that’s concerning. Your dog’s paws come into contact with a myriad of unseen substances. These can include anything from pesticides and fertilizers on lawns to tiny bits of broken glass or sharp stones that can cause microscopic cuts. In addition, common allergens like pollen or mold spores can cling to their fur, potentially triggering allergic reactions for both your pet and human family members once inside your living space.

At its core, an automatic paw cleaner works like a miniature, gentle washing machine specifically designed for your dog’s paws. You typically add a little water, insert your dog’s paw, and with a simple button click, the internal soft silicone bristles gently rotate. These bristles work together to loosen and remove dirt, mud, and debris from all angles, including those hard-to-reach spots between the pads. It’s designed to be a comfortable experience for your dog, often feeling like a soothing massage rather than an intrusive cleaning.

Making the Smart Choice for Your Dog and Home
When considering an automatic paw cleaner, look for features like soft, durable silicone bristles, ease of disassembly for cleaning the device itself, and a comfortable design that accommodates your dog’s paw size. Some models are also portable, making them ideal for use on the go, such as after a muddy hike or a trip to the dog park.
